Output 2860c544ca4dc3bcb5560f2dbbb70335ddf16469be90478495c2e9f3014ff9ce:18

value
177200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87a4c4f1048694e8c242e5715e6738261eb8a5bf OP_EQUAL
address
3E4EXp6DMwyKjQrGZUK9Y7dBWvZPxugmQb
transaction
2860c544ca4dc3bcb5560f2dbbb70335ddf16469be90478495c2e9f3014ff9ce